Maximize Solar Utilization

IONZERA's low resistance means less energy lost as heat in the membrane, converting more of each solar kWh into hydrogen chemical energy.

Handle Solar Variability

Solar output follows a daily curve and varies with cloud cover. IONZERA's high wettability and stable pore structure maintain performance across the variable load profile.
